Given an array nums. We define a running sum of an array as runningSum[i] = sum(nums[0]…nums[i]).
Return the running sum of nums.
Example 1:
Input: nums = [1,2,3,4]
Output: [1,3,6,10]
Explanation: Running sum is obtained as follows: [1, 1+2, 1+2+3, 1+2+3+4].
类似于图像中的积分数组,i 处为0~i 为止的元素和。
思路:
DP
public int[] runningSum(int[] nums) {
int n = nums.length

该博客介绍了如何使用动态规划计算一个数组的累加和,提供了一个Java实现的示例代码。示例中,通过循环遍历数组并累加前一个元素的累加和来得到当前元素的累加和,最终返回结果数组。
最低0.47元/天 解锁文章
383

被折叠的 条评论
为什么被折叠?



